For a family of all ages, I would suggest the Hoop De Doo Revue. It is a dinner show and entertaining for young and old alike. Good comfort food too. Fried chicken, BBQ ribs, strawberry shortcake. It is two table service credits for each person but a good deal IMO. (Also all the beer and/or shangria you can drink along with bus service back to all Disney resorts). It is located at the Fort Wilderness Campground.
